You asked: How do I use SCSS in react project?

Can we use SCSS in react?

Introduction: We can use SASS in React using a package called node-sass. Using node-sass we can just create sass files and use them as the normal CSS files in our React application and node-sass will take care of compiling sass files.

What is SCSS in react?

Sass is a CSS pre-processor. Sass files are executed on the server and sends CSS to the browser. You can learn more about Sass in our Sass Tutorial.

How do I run a SCSS file?

Running Sass in the Command Line

Type “pwd” (aka “print working directory” to make sure you’re in the right spot. Once you have your Sass files written, you’re ready to go! The command to run Sass is sass –watch input. scss output.

How do you call SCSS in react?


  1. Install node-sass: npm install node-sass.
  2. Change file extension . css to . scss.
  3. Import your . scss files in your React components.

How do I use SCSS in HTML?

Syntax highlighting widely used CSS tool and is supported in SCSS.

  1. create a folder of scss and then create a file that should be style.scss.
  2. create a folder of CSS and then create a file that should be style.css.
  3. Then use this cmd.
Why do we need sass?

Sass (which stands for ‘Syntactically awesome style sheets) is an extension of CSS that enables you to use things like variables, nested rules, inline imports and more. It also helps to keep things organised and allows you to create style sheets faster. Sass is compatible with all versions of CSS.

How do I compile all SCSS files?

Watch and Compile Sass in Five Quick Steps

  1. Install Node. js. …
  2. Initialize NPM. NPM is the Node Package Manager for JavaScript. …
  3. Install Node-Sass. Node-sass is an NPM package that compiles Sass to CSS (which it does very quickly too). …
  4. Write Node-sass Command. …
  5. Run the Script.

Is CSS better than SCSS?

SCSS contains all the features of CSS and contains more features that are not present in CSS which makes it a good choice for developers to use it. SCSS is full of advanced features. SCSS offers variables, you can shorten your code by using variables. It is a great advantage over conventional CSS.

How do you save a SCSS file?

Assuming you have the SASS gem installed (and you’re in a ruby environment), do the following in the command line:

  1. Navigate to the folder in which your . scss file/s are kept.
  2. Run the following command: sass –watch style. scss:style. css.

How do I import a scss file into typescript react?

you need some steps on your projects.

  1. git commit all changes.
  2. run yarn run eject from your project command prompt.
  3. Go to the location and open the file config/ approximately line #173. …
  4. Go to the location and open the file config/ approximately line #185.
Can you use Sass with CSS modules?

5 Answers. You will have to install node-sass in order to work with scss files. Your code seems to be alright as post react 16.8 you can use module css and scss without configuring webpack.

What is the difference between Sass and node-Sass?

scss (or . sass ) in Node you have the choice between sass and node-sass . sass is a JavaScript compilation of Dart Sass which is supposedly “the primary implementation of Sass” which is a pretty powerful statement. node-sass on the other hand is a wrapper on LibSass which is written in C++.

